如何配置Maven项目属性

tamoadmin 热门赛事 2024-04-25 27 0

配置Maven项目属性涉及到在POM.XML文件中设置和管理项目的属性。这些属性可以是版本号、依赖项、插件等。以下是如何配置Maven项目属性的基本步骤:

如何配置Maven项目属性

1.打开你的Maven项目,在项目的根目录下找到`pom.xml`文件。

2.在`pom.xml`文件中,找到``标签,它位于``元素内部。如果没有``标签,你可以自己添加一个。

3.在``标签内,你可以定义自己的属性。例如,如果你想要定义一个属性叫做`my.property`,你可以这样写:

```xml

myValue

```

4.一旦你定义了属性,你就可以在整个`pom.xml`文件中使用`${my.property}`来引用这个属性的值。

5.如果你想在不同的模块中共享相同的属性,你可以把这些属性放在父POM中,所有的子模块都会继承这些属性。

6.除了在`pom.xml`中直接定义属性之外,你还可以在Maven的`settings.xml`文件中定义全局属性。这些属性对于所有的Maven项目都是可用的。`settings.xml`文件通常位于`$M2_HOME/conf`目录下。

7.在`settings.xml`文件中,找到``标签,并在其中添加一个新的配置文件,如下所示:

```xml

myprofile

myValue

```

8.通过在命令行中激活这个配置文件,你可以使用定义在`settings.xml`中的属性。例如,要激活上面定义的"profile",你可以运行以下命令:

```bash

mvn

P

myprofile

```

9.另外,你也可以在`pom.xml`中引用外部属性文件,例如:

```xml

${basedir}/src/main/resources/config.properties

```

在这个例子中,`config.properties`文件应该位于项目的`src/main/resources`目录下。

通过以上步骤,你可以方便地在Maven项目中管理和使用属性。这将有助于你更好地组织和维护你的项目配置。